Verdict
Casimiro Pérez makes a cleaner bicuishe than madrecuishe at the same ABV tier, which isn't surprising, bicuishe tolerates lower proof better than its heavier karwinskii cousin. At 46% this madrecuishe lands as a stepped-down version of what it could be. Pass and reach for Mal Bien's Cortés madrecuishe at 48.82% for the reference.
Madrecuishe asking for more proof than 46% gives
Tasting notes
Nose: Wet grass with starchy note, mineral
Palate: 46% is below the 48% madrecuishe ceiling where the agave's starchy density really drives – Casimiro Pérez's cut is clean, the mid-palate doesn't fully develop
Finish: Medium-long, dry, soft
The bottom line
A fair madrecuishe, not the one to buy
